    Don't stress too much over the Protein and Fluid numbers. Your body has Protein stores to last you for several weeks, and as long as you're urinating every 4 hours or so you've got adequate fluids. It's very hard to get all those "requirements" in at first when your stomach is so tiny and swollen. It does get much easier!

    As to not losing much in the first week post-op, keep in mind that they overloaded you with IV fluids during surgery to help with the nausea. It takes time for your kidneys to kick in and get rid of all that extra Fluid, which weighs a lot by the way! If you follow doctor's orders, the weight will come off easily, I promise you!
